Note N747Obit from the Lufkin Daily News on 11 Feb 2004 Wyman M. Bridges, Lt.Col., USAF (ret) Services for Wyman M. Bridges, Lt.Col., USAF (ret), 83, of Huntington, will be held at 2:30 p.m., Wednesday in the Gipson-Metcalf Funeral Home Chapel in Lufkin with Dr. Darryl R. Smith and Rev. Grady Lowery officiating. Interment will follow in the Garden of Memories Memorial Park. Mr. Bridges was born April 10, 1920, in Center, Texas, the son of Mary (Grubbs) and Rodgers Bridges; and he died Monday, February 9, 2004, in a Lufkin hospital. Mr. Bridges was retired from the United States Air Force, following 30 years of service. At the time of his retirement, he had attained the rank of Lieutenant Colonel, and had been stationed in numerous places including Japan, Okinawa and Germany. Mr. Bridges was a 50-year member of the Homer Masonic Lodge No. 254, A.F. & A.M., in Huntington and of the Arabia Temple of the Shrine. He had resided in Huntington for the past 33 years. Survivors include his wife, Sue Lowery Bridges of Huntington; sons and daughters-in-law, Steve and Joyce Bridges of Sierra Vista, California, and Tracey and Nancy Bridges of Charlotte, North Carolina; and brother, Merrill Bridges of Dallas. Honorary pallbearers will be all of his nephews. Gipson-Metcalf Funeral Directors of Lufkin.
